What Is a Credit Report in a Home Loan?

A credit report in the context of a home loan is a crucial document that provides a snapshot of your credit history. Here is what it does:

  • A credit report is a comprehensive record of your financial history.
  • It includes information about loans, credit cards, payment history, and outstanding debts.

Top Reasons for its Importance:

  • Loan Approval: Lenders use credit reports to assess the risk associated with lending money to an applicant.
  • Interest Rates: A credit report with high credit scores often results in lower interest rates.
  • Loan Amount: It determines the maximum loan amount you may qualify for.

Key Components of a Credit Report:

  • Personal Information (name, address, etc.)
  • Credit Score
  • Credit Accounts (loans, credit cards)
  • Payment History

Outstanding Debts
